A lawsuit was filed in federal district court today against the first significant update to environmental protection standards at Lake Tahoe since 1987.The deadline for challenges to the plan was midnight Tuesday.The plaintiffs, the Sierra Club and the Friends of the West Shore, filed suit against the updates to the Lake Tahoe Regional Plan that were approved by the TRPA Governing Board in December.TRPA Executive Director Joanne Marchetta said the Sierra Club's action goes against current scientific and sustainability principles, including those that the National Sierra Club has endorsed in published reports, and delays policy improvements needed to save the …
